在Linux系统中,可通过以下方法查看CPU缓存大小:
lscpu
命令:在终端输入lscpu
,输出结果中会显示各级缓存大小,如L1d cache
(一级数据缓存)、L1i cache
(一级指令缓存)、L2 cache
(二级缓存)、L3 cache
(三级缓存)。/proc/cpuinfo
文件:执行cat /proc/cpuinfo
命令,在输出中查找cache size
字段,但此方法可能仅显示部分缓存信息。/sys/devices/system/cpu/
目录:通过ls /sys/devices/system/cpu/cpu0/cache/
可查看缓存索引文件,再用cat
命令查看具体缓存大小,如cat /sys/devices/system/cpu/cpu0/cache/index0/size
。